My go to that has everything for quilting is "The Quilting Answer Book" by Barbara Weiland Talbert. You can get it in a portable edition looks to be about 5 x 7 - it has everything about making a quilt from start to finish - including math, binding, fabric, and everything. I use this book to teach myself anything about quilting.
